History of Hoboken
ST. FRANCIS' R. C. CHURCH.

Originally published in 1907
THIS WEB VERSION COPYRIGHT 2003 GET NJ

St. Francis' Church, at Third and Jefferson Streets, was erected by the Italian Catholics of Hoboken. In April, 1888, the site, 100 x 100 was Purchased and in May, 1889, the church was ready for occupancy. The edifice was blessed and dedicated by Right Rev. Conroy, former Bishop of Albany. The following year the parsonage adjoining the church was built. The total outlay at that time was about $30,000. Rev. Domenick Marzetti was in charge of the parish from its organization till the time of his death. He was beloved by his people, who deeply regretted his demise, which occurred on the 12th of April, 1902.

Father Marzetti was succeeded by Rev. Ambrose Rheiner, April 13, 1902, who at once began the erection of the present large and beautiful school. Father Rheiner, was in charge of the parish to the time of his removal in January, 1905.

The work begun on the parochial school was completed by Rev. Seraphim Pierotti, D.D.., the present rector, who was sent from Albany, where he was Professor of Philosophy and Theology at the Franciscan College. During the present administration improvements to a very noticeable degree are being made. The interior of the church has been completely renovated, a beautiful white marble altar railing has been erected and many other things too numerous to mention have been completed. The parish at the present time numbers about 2,000 souls. The total value of church property is estimated at about $65,000.
